Satisfaction rate not showing in mails sent from Filter Subscriptions

      Issue Summary
      • When subscribing to a filter that contains the Satisfaction field in its results, the value (1 to 5 starts) of the Satisfaction field is not shown in the mail.
      Steps to Reproduce
      1. Go to the Issue navigator, make a search
      2. Include the Field 'Satisfaction' in the columns visible.
      3. Save the Filter.
      4. Subscribe to the filter.
      Expected Behavior
      • An email is received containing the Filter results at the time the subscription mail was sent, including the Satisfaction field values.
      Actual Behavior
      • An email is received containing the Filter results at the time the subscription mail was sent, but the Satisfaction value appears empty. See example:

      Cause
      • Unknown, possibly the mail template not being prepared to handle the data format from the Satisfaction field.
      Workaround
      • None
